UI doesn't load for one user - anyone had a similar problem?

On our test server, on one particular database, one particular user doesn't get an UI when logging in. I've tried digging into the frontend calls, and it seems it's this call:

https://{our test server}/Server/MetaData.asmx/GetConfigurableUi?accept=json&database={one particular db}&date=2025-05-02T13%3A01%3A58.94&item_classification=%25all_grouped_by_classification%25&item_type_id=&lang=en&location_name=TOC&user={me}

which fails, with a "not a single item" fault. I am in fact logged in, and can e.g. go see the session information on the user button. Deleting all client side caches or logging in with incognito mode makes no difference.

 

Have anyone else experienced this?
